黑狐家游戏

比价网站源码解析,技术架构、商业逻辑与开源实践,比价网站源码

欧气 1 0

(全文约3287字)

技术架构演进:从基础框架到智能决策系统 1.1 前端架构设计 现代比价网站采用渐进式Web应用(PWA)架构,通过React/Vue框架实现动态渲染,头部平台如Google Shopping采用微前端架构,将商品展示、搜索框、比价图表等模块解耦为独立微服务,前端性能优化方面,采用Webpack代码分割、Service Worker缓存策略,关键接口响应时间控制在200ms以内。

2 分布式后端架构 主流架构方案包含:

比价网站源码解析,技术架构、商业逻辑与开源实践,比价网站源码

图片来源于网络,如有侵权联系删除

  • Nginx+Docker容器化部署
  • Spring Cloud微服务集群(Spring Boot 3.0+)
  • Kafka实时数据流处理
  • Redis Cluster分布式缓存(热点数据TTL优化至30分钟)
  • Elasticsearch商品搜索引擎(支持多维度复合查询)

典型案例:某头部比价平台采用三数据中心容灾架构,通过VPC网络隔离保障数据安全,订单处理系统达到2000TPS并发能力。

3 数据采集系统 价格采集模块采用混合爬虫架构:

  • 端到端爬虫(Scrapy+Python3.11)
  • 智能OCR识别(Tesseract 5.0+PaddleOCR)
  • 反爬机制破解(User-Agent轮换池+动态代理)
  • 数据清洗管道(Apache NiFi) 某平台日采集数据量达50TB,经ETL处理后形成结构化数据库(MySQL 8.0 InnoDB+Redis 7.0)

核心功能模块解构 2.1 多源价格采集引擎

  • 支持HTTP/HTTPS/API三种采集方式
  • 自定义数据抓取规则(XPath/CSS选择器)
  • 价格波动监控(阈值告警:±3%)
  • 商品信息抽取(标题、SKU、参数、图片)
  • 验证码识别(活体检测+滑块破解)

2 智能比价算法

  • 基础比价模型:价格差值计算(带时间衰减因子)
  • 多维度对比:运费、退换货政策、售后服务
  • 竞争分析:市场价中位数预测(移动平均法)
  • 个性化推荐:协同过滤(用户行为日志分析)
  • 动态权重系统:权重参数动态调整(基于A/B测试)

3 用户交互系统

  • 实时比价看板(ECharts可视化)
  • 价格历史曲线(折线图+波动指数)
  • 比价清单管理(支持Excel导入导出)
  • 智能提醒系统(价格预警、促销通知)
  • 社区互动模块(用户点评、问答系统)

4 数据存储方案

  • 主从读写分离架构
  • 分库分表策略(按品类、地区)
  • 冷热数据分层存储(HDFS+Alluxio)
  • 灾备方案:跨机房数据同步(MaxCompute+MinIO)

开源生态实践 3.1 主流开源项目选型

  • 价格采集:Scrapy(Python)、Octoparse(可视化)
  • 数据分析:Apache Spark(实时计算)
  • 搜索引擎:Elasticsearch(7.17+)
  • 推荐系统:Faiss(向量检索)
  • 前端框架:Vue3组合式API

2 开源社区贡献模式

  • GitHub趋势TOP50项目:ParseHub、Oodle Shopping
  • 贡献方式:代码提交(PR)、文档完善、测试用例
  • 专利技术开源:某平台开放比价算法核心模块
  • 企业级解决方案:Docker镜像+Kubernetes部署指南

3 开源与商业平衡

  • 闭源模块:支付接口、风控系统
  • 开源策略:核心算法开源+增值服务收费
  • 生态共建:API经济模式(按调用次数计费)
  • 案例分析:某平台通过开源爬虫框架年创收$2M

技术挑战与优化 4.1 数据质量治理

  • 异常数据处理:价格为负值/零值检测
  • 重复数据过滤:Jaccard相似度算法
  • 数据同步一致性:CRDT算法应用
  • 数据版本控制:Git-LFS管理大文件

2 系统性能优化

  • 缓存策略:三级缓存体系(本地缓存+Redis+DB)
  • 响应时间优化:CDN加速(Cloudflare)
  • 资源消耗控制:JVM调优(G1垃圾回收)
  • 压力测试:JMeter模拟万级并发

3 法律合规问题

  • 网络爬虫合规:Robots协议遵守
  • 数据隐私保护:GDPR/CCPA合规
  • 支付安全:PCI DSS三级认证
  • 竞争合规:反垄断审查要点

行业未来趋势 5.1 技术融合创新

  • AR/VR比价:WebXR实现3D商品对比
  • 区块链应用:分布式价格索引(Hyperledger Fabric)
  • 生成式AI:自动生成比价报告(GPT-4 API集成)
  • 物联网比价:智能硬件价格监控(MQTT协议)

2 商业模式进化

比价网站源码解析,技术架构、商业逻辑与开源实践,比价网站源码

图片来源于网络,如有侵权联系删除

  • 订阅制服务:高级比价功能会员制
  • 数据增值服务:行业价格指数报告
  • 交易闭环构建:支付分账系统开发
  • 跨境比价:RCEP区域多币种结算

3 伦理与社会责任

  • 算法透明度:A/B测试结果公示
  • 价格保护机制:虚假宣传投诉通道
  • 可持续发展:绿色数据中心建设
  • 公益服务:助农比价专区开发

开发实践指南 6.1 技术选型建议

  • 初创团队:Django+MySQL+AWS
  • 中型项目:Spring Cloud+Kubernetes
  • 头部平台:自研微服务+混合云

2 开发流程规范

  • CI/CD:GitLab CI+Jenkins
  • 代码审查:SonarQube静态扫描
  • 安全测试:OWASP ZAP渗透测试
  • 灾备演练:每月全链路压测

3 团队协作模式

  • 敏捷开发:Scrum框架(2周迭代)
  • 技术债务管理:SonarQube监控
  • 知识共享:Confluence文档库
  • 人才培养:黑客马拉松机制

典型案例分析 7.1 欧洲比价平台Price comparison Group

  • 技术架构:Kubernetes集群(200+节点)
  • 核心算法:LSTM预测价格波动
  • 用户规模:1.2亿月活
  • 特色功能:碳足迹比价

2 亚太地区比价平台iPrice Group

  • 数据采集:多语言NLP处理(支持12种语言)
  • 支付系统:聚合支付接口(支持88种支付方式)
  • 机器学习:用户流失预测模型(准确率92%)
  • 社区建设:UGC内容生产激励计划

3 中国本土创新平台比价猫

  • 特色技术:图像识别比价(准确率98%)
  • 合规体系:通过国家信息安全三级等保
  • 增值服务:电子合同在线签署
  • 跨境服务:RCEP国家比价通道

未来技术展望 8.1 量子计算应用

  • 优化价格计算复杂度(从O(n²)到O(n))
  • 加速机器学习模型训练
  • 提升加密安全性(抗量子密码算法)

2 数字孪生技术

  • 构建虚拟商业生态模型
  • 实时模拟价格波动影响
  • 智能决策支持系统

3 元宇宙融合

  • 虚拟商品价格追踪
  • 跨平台比价NFT应用
  • 元宇宙经济体系构建

比价网站源码开发已从简单的数据采集工具进化为融合AI、区块链、物联网的智能商业平台,随着技术进步,未来的比价系统将深度融入数字经济生态,成为连接消费者与商家的价值枢纽,开发者需持续关注技术前沿,在技术创新与商业伦理间寻求平衡,构建可持续发展的比价生态系统。

(注:本文数据来源于Gartner 2023技术报告、Statista行业分析、头部平台技术白皮书及公开技术文档,案例均做匿名化处理)

标签: #比价网站 源码

黑狐家游戏
  • 评论列表

留言评论